How To Fix EL157 - No meter reading orders created for device &1


SAP Error Message - Details

  • Message type: E = Error

  • Message class: EL - IS-U meter reading data processing

  • Message number: 157

  • Message text: No meter reading orders created for device &1

  • What is the cause and solution for SAP error message EL157 - No meter reading orders created for device &1 ?

    The SAP error message EL157 "No meter reading orders created for device &1" typically occurs in the context of SAP IS-U (Industry Solution for Utilities) when the system is unable to generate meter reading orders for a specific device (e.g., a utility meter). This can happen for various reasons, and understanding the cause is essential for resolving the issue.

    Causes:

    1. Device Status: The device may be in a status that does not allow for meter reading orders to be created. For example, if the device is inactive or decommissioned, the system will not generate orders.

    2. Reading Period: The meter reading period may not be defined correctly, or the current date may fall outside the defined reading period.

    3. Configuration Issues: There may be configuration issues in the meter reading order generation settings, such as missing or incorrect settings in the device type or reading type.

    4. No Readings Required: The system may determine that no readings are required for the device based on the configuration or business rules.

    5. Technical Issues: There could be technical issues, such as missing data in the master data records for the device.

    Solutions:

    1. Check Device Status: Verify the status of the device in the system. Ensure that it is active and eligible for meter reading.

    2. Review Reading Period: Check the meter reading calendar and ensure that the reading period is correctly defined and that the current date falls within this period.

    3. Configuration Review: Review the configuration settings for meter reading orders. Ensure that the device type and reading type are correctly set up to allow for order generation.

    4. Check Meter Reading Requirements: Ensure that the business rules and settings allow for meter readings to be generated for the device in question.

    5. Master Data Verification: Check the master data for the device to ensure that all necessary information is present and correct.

    6. Transaction Codes: Use relevant transaction codes (e.g., EL31 for meter reading order creation) to manually check or create meter reading orders if necessary.
